DESCRIPTION

The Series 681XXC Synthesized Signal Generators are microproces-
sor-based, synthesized signal sources with high resolution phase-lock
capability. They generate both broad (full range) and narrow band
sweeps and discrete CW frequencies across the frequency range of
10 MHz to 65 GHz. All functions of the signal generator are fully con-
trollable locally from the front panel or remotely (except for power
on/standby) via the IEEE-488 General Purpose Interface Bus (GPIB).

The series presently consists of seven models covering a variety of fre-
quency and power ranges. Table 1-1, page 1-4, lists models, frequency
ranges, and maximum leveled output.
